#052694 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#052694 is composed of 2% red, 14.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 226.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30%. #052694 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a4cff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#052694 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#052694 has RGB values of R:5, G:38,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 337556.

Shades and Tints of #052694
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#052694
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4d is the less saturated color, while #052694 is the most saturated one.
